Patisserie Holdings, the AIM-list group, has been named IPO of the Year at the Grant Thornton Quoted Company Awards 2015 to recognise high-achieving listed companies quoted below the FTSE 350 through to AIM and ISDX.

The companies in the category were judged by a panel of specialists based on the amount of money raised, the costs of float, timing, sector and the type of company floated. The judges then assessed the valuation of the company as well as performance since float.

Paul May, chief executive said: “This is a great achievement for Patisserie Holdings and we are delighted to have won this prestigious award. We’ve worked extremely hard to make this business a success, and will continue to do so.”

Patisserie Holdings is the UK’s largest patisserie cafe chain with over 150 sites nationwide. The company operates five brands - Patisserie Valerie, Druckers Vienna Patisserie, Baker & Spice, Flower Power City Bakery and Philpotts.
